Transaction 03c948dca831fac282389f9bf492df569398f89c52444d4742e238be83105c8e

1 Input
2 Outputs
  • 03c948dca831fac282389f9bf492df569398f89c52444d4742e238be83105c8e:0
  • value  532487
    address  3HomBVDiwZQXApnUCqhctK3PYmszsApWxk
  • 03c948dca831fac282389f9bf492df569398f89c52444d4742e238be83105c8e:1
  • value  59942814
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d